Mastering WidgetKit in SwiftUI 4, iOS 16 with Dynamic Island - Focus Timer Attributes

Mastering WidgetKit in SwiftUI 4, iOS 16 with Dynamic Island - Focus Timer Attributes

Assessment

Interactive Video

Information Technology (IT), Architecture

University

Hard

Created by

Quizizz Content

FREE Resource

This video tutorial guides viewers through the setup and development of a live activity project using Xcode 14.1. It covers the creation of project folders for the app and widget components, the definition of activity attributes, and the structuring of content state for the focus timer. The tutorial emphasizes the importance of using the correct Xcode version and importing necessary kits.

Read more

5 questions

Show all answers

1.

MULTIPLE CHOICE QUESTION

30 sec • 1 pt

What are the two main components of the live activity project discussed in the video?

Frontend and backend

Design and development

User interface and database

App side and widget side

2.

MULTIPLE CHOICE QUESTION

30 sec • 1 pt

Why is it important to use Xcode 14.1 for the live activity project?

It is easier to use

It is the latest version available

It supports live activities and Activity Kit

It has better performance

3.

MULTIPLE CHOICE QUESTION

30 sec • 1 pt

What is the purpose of creating a folder named 'Focus Timer app'?

To store unrelated files

To organize files related to the main app

To keep backup files

To share files with other projects

4.

MULTIPLE CHOICE QUESTION

30 sec • 1 pt

What protocol must the struct conform to when defining activity attributes?

Hashable

Decodable

Encodable

Activity Attributes

5.

MULTIPLE CHOICE QUESTION

30 sec • 1 pt

What is the maximum size for dynamic data encoded by the content state in live activities?

4 kilobytes

2 kilobytes

6 kilobytes

8 kilobytes